1. Ensuring Tax Obligations at All Levels
Managing taxes in Canada requires a comprehensive strategy that encompasses federal and provincial requirements. Each level has specific obligations and deadlines that businesses must follow:
Federal Tax Obligations
Corporate Income Tax Returns
GST/HST Filings
Payroll Deductions and Remittances
T4 and T5 Information Returns
Provincial Tax Requirements
Provincial Sales Tax (where applicable)
Employer Health Tax (EHT)
Workers' Compensation Premiums
Provincial Corporate Tax Variations
Key Tax Deadlines in Canada
T2 Corporate Tax Returns – Due 6 months after fiscal year-end
T4 Submissions – Due February 28th of the following year
GST/HST Returns – Due monthly, quarterly, or annually, based on revenue
Payroll Remittances – Due 15th of each month for most businesses
Common Tax Filing Errors
❌ Misclassification of workers (employees vs. contractors)
❌ Incorrect expense categorization
❌ Missing documentation for claimed deductions
❌ Late filing penalties and interest charges
❌ Incorrect GST/HST input tax credit claims

2. Strengthening Internal Financial Controls
Internal financial controls help businesses maintain accurate financial reporting and prevent financial fraud. These are systematic measures put in place to protect company assets and
avoid costly mistakes.
Key Components of Internal Controls
✅ Segregation of Duties: Ensuring different employees handle different financial transactions.
✅ Authorization Protocols: Implementing approval requirements for financial decisions.
✅ Physical Controls: Secure storage of financial records and assets.
✅ Documentation Standards: Detailed record-keeping for all financial activities.
✅ Regular Monitoring: Ongoing financial audits and assessments.
Essential Control Procedures
Daily bank reconciliations
Regular inventory audits
Automated financial controls
Independent financial reviews

What financial regulations do Canadian businesses need to follow?
Canadian businesses must follow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P)and meet federal and provincial tax obligations, including corporate tax filings, GST/HST remittances, and payroll deductions.
